Why PUBG Mobile Was Banned?

PUBG Mobile, made by Tencent Games, was one of the most played games in India. The game was published by Tencent Games, a Chinese company. In September 2020, the Government of India banned hundreds of Chinese games and apps on the Play Store. This was due to growing concerns about privacy and increasing tensions between the two countries.

Later, in December 2020, Krafton started working on an Indian version of PUBG Mobile that met with all the terms and conditions laid by the Indian Government. They also said that they would take privacy and security measures seriously. Eventually, Battlegrounds Mobile India was teased on the Play Store and the game is currently up for pre-registration. Even though the name has been changed, at its core the game is still very similar to PUBG Mobile.

Why Gameloop is not working?

Gameloop is very popular among players who want to play their favorite mobile games on PC. Before Gameloop was known by its current name, it was called Tencent Gaming Buddy. But, due to the recent ban of Chinese apps and games on the Play Store, some users believe that Gameloop will be banned too, as it is made by Tencent Games.

As of now, the emulator is not banned in India. But many players have reported that Gameloop is not working for them when trying to download BGMI and other games on it. Also, some players have reported their installation of Gameloop being stuck at 25%. Here are few ways to fix Gameloop not downloading games.

  • First, you need to set up a VPN on your PC before downloading the emulator. Any VPN should work, as long as it connects to a server outside India.

Connect to VPN

  • Next, you need to download the latest edition of Gameloop from here. Choose the latest beta version available for more features and support.
  • Keeping the VPN connected, start the installation of the emulator. If you get stuck at 25% or get some other error while installing, then disconnect from the VPN, reconnect to another server. Then restart the setup from the beginning.
  • This is a one-time process only, so you don’t need to worry about starting the VPN again and again while playing the game on the emulator.

How to Download Battlegrounds India in Gameloop

There are two ways to install BGMI in Gameloop. If the first method doesn’t work for you, then use the second one.

First Method (For Pre-Registered Users)

  • Now that you have Gameloop installed and running on your PC, open the emulator and sign in to your Google account.
  • First of all, you need to launch any game in Gameloop from either the game center or choose from one of the preinstalled ones.

launch any game on Gameloop

  • Once you’ve opened the game, press the back button twice on the emulator to get back to this screen.

backspace

  • Next, press F9 on your keyboard to gain access to the hidden menu inside the emulator.

Access Gameloop browser

  • Launch the browser and search for play.google.com. Now click on the first link to launch Google Play Store in Gameloop.

launch Google Play Store in Gameloop

  • Now that you have access to Play Store, you can download the beta of Battlegrounds Mobile India from there. In case you didn’t pre-register for the game, you can do so from this link. Make sure you register with the same Google account that you use in Play Store.
  • Once the game finishes the installation, you can start playing it right away after logging in through Facebook or Twitter.

Second Method

In case you can’t access the Play Store, or face some other issue with the above steps, take a look at this alternate way of installing BGMI in Gameloop.

  • Follow the previous method till step four. Once you have access to the inbuilt browser, download the ES File Explorer APK from APKpure.

download es file explorer

  • Next, you will have to download the Battleground Mobile India apk and obb files (Download link).
  • Once the files are downloaded, extract the zip files and copy them to this location (D:\Temp\TxGameDownload\MobileGamePCShared).

PUBG MobileGamePCShared

  • Now open ES Explorer in Gameloop emulator,  and navigate to Internal storage> / > Data > Share1.

es explorer

  • Here you will find Battlegrounds Mobile India APK and OBB files. Click on the APK file to install Battlegrounds Mobile India.

Install Battleground mobile India Early Access In Gameloop

  • Once installed, copy the com.pubg.imobile folder and paste it in Internal storage > / > Storage > emulated > 0 > Android > obb.

paste obb files

  • Next, run the game from the home menu of Gameloop. You should now be able to play the game from your PC.

Note: If you have successfully installed the game on the emulator, it is possible that you can’t access it due to errors like “Server is busy, please try again later. Error code: restrict-area.” In this case, you need to use a VPN with the location set as India and connect to it before starting the game.
